人工智能软件怎么去学习呢

您正在使用IE低版浏览器为了您嘚雷锋网账号安全和更好的产品体验,强烈建议使用更快更安全的浏览器

《和哈佛教授学AI》KIDS AID-课程介绍01【青尐年的第一堂人工智能课】

Kids AID是由哈佛教授Kostas亲自编写并教授的专注于人工智能和设计的青少年思维课程 课程打破了人们对人工智唯“技术”唯“工具”的传统认知。从AI设计思维出发探寻智慧之美、设计之美。 课程由代码和故事两部分同步进行 第一部分,代码涉及简单嘚基本代码知识,这个过程中强调随机性和意想不到的互动孩子们从平面图形基础开始学习,辨析AI运行的“道法”逻辑探究世界运行嘚因果和逻辑。在此过程中需要让孩子们明白电脑可以以意想不到的方式和他们互动和交流这有助于扩宽儿童的想象力。 第二部分讲故事。这一部分是通过具有挑战性的故事培养儿童的想象力从图像处理、人脸识别到社会伦理关系,从分形几何到户牍古建从古希腊鉮话的塞浦路斯国王到中国古代传说蟾宫仙子嫦娥......通过使用最原始的方式,如讲故事、语言表达、神话、备忘录、游戏或拼图的方法来探究孩子们与生俱来的“智慧”能力让学生们在理解自我“智慧”的基础上,提升应对当今复杂社会和解决问题的能力 康思大 Kostas Terzidi 哈佛大学設计学院 教授; 同济大学设计创意学院 教授; Organic Parking公司 首席执行官(CEO); THE MEME Design 首席技术官(CTO); 世界顶尖算法设计专家。 Kostas Terzidis拥有密歇根大学建筑与计算机科学的博士学位他在包括辛辛那提大学、UCLA、哈佛大学GSD在内的知名设计专业任过教。Kostas 他的研究项目包括“旋转对称物体的采样与重建”及“知识辅助建筑问题求解与设计”

1、学习并掌握好数学知识:高等數学是学习人工智能的基础一起理工科都需要这个打底,数据挖掘、人工智能、模式识别此类跟数据打交道的又尤其需要多元微积分运算基础线性代数很重要,现行模型是你最先考虑的模型未来很可能还要处理多维数据,需要用线性代数来简洁清晰的描述问题为分析求解奠定基础。概率论、数理统计、随机过程更是少不了涉及数据的问题,不确定性几乎是不可避免的引入随机变量顺理成章,相關理论、方法、模型非常丰富再就是优化理论与算法,除非你的问题是像二元一次方程求根那样有现成的公式否则你将不得不面对各種看起来无解但是要解的问题,优化将是你的GPS为你指路有了以上基础就可以开始机器学习的理论和算法了,以后再具体针对某一个应用補充相关的知识与理论比如数值计算、图论、拓扑等。

2、学习机器学习的理论和算法:回归算法、基于实例的算法、正则化方法、决策樹学习、贝叶斯算法、深度学习、人工神经网络······

3、掌握一种编程语言Python:一方面Python是脚本语言简便,拿个记事本就能写写完拿控淛台就能跑;另外,Python非常高效效率比java、r、matlab高。matlab虽然包也多但是效率是这四个里面最低的。行业动态及论文:了解行业最新动态和研究荿果比如各大牛的经典论文、博客、读书笔记、微博微信等媒体资讯。实践练习:找一个开源框架自己多动手训练深度神经网络,多動手写写代码多做一些与人工智能相关的项目。找到自己感兴趣的方向:人工智能有很多方向比如NLP、语音识别、计算机视觉等等,生命有限必须得选一个方向深入的专研下去,这样才能成为人工智能领域的大牛有所成就。

我要回帖

 

随机推荐